Finance Manager

Location: Dublin, Republic of Ireland
Contract Type: Full-Time | Permanent

Salary: €60,000 - €65,000 plus Sodexo Benefits

About the Role

We are seeking a commercially focused Finance Manager to support a key Corporate Services account in Ireland.

This is a strategic business partnering role where you will work closely with operational leaders, supporting budgeting, forecasting, financial reporting, and commercial decision-making across a large contract environment.

You will play a key role in driving financial performance, supporting client reporting, and providing clear financial insight to operational teams and stakeholders.

Key Responsibilities
Manage all financial planning, budgeting, and forecasting processes for the contract.
Deliver accurate monthly accounts, variance analysis, and financial commentary.
Support the Account Manager and operational teams in key business decisions.
Coordinate month-end close, invoicing, and reporting processes with internal teams.
Ensure financial controls, risk management, and compliance processes are in place.
Provide financial insight to identify trends, risks, and opportunities for improvement.
Present financial performance at client and internal review meetings.

Lead initiatives to improve efficiency, streamline processes, and support growth.

What We Are Looking For
Degree-level education or equivalent, with an accounting qualification (or working towards one).
Minimum 5 years’ experience in finance, ideally within a contract or service-based environment.
Strong commercial awareness and business partnering experience.
Excellent analytical and communication skills, with the ability to present complex information clearly.
Hands-on approach with a proactive attitude and attention to detail.

Strong proficiency in Microsoft Excel; SAP experience is desirable.
